The Sept 6th episode was a cute one… in total Doc McStuffins style, she’s helping people. What I personally loved about this episode was Doc fixing the Big Jack in the Jack-in-the-Box. It was cute to see the relationship between Little Jack and Big Jack and see Doc come in and help out. She fixed Big Jack, but at the same time, Little Jack saw that he can go out and do something on his own. I loved how they honed in on a father/son relationship. It was a cute message and a wonderful episode for my son to see.
